Senior Quantitative Financial Analyst

Onsite | Hybrid

3 days onsite required

New York, NY

We are looking for someone with a business analyst skillset to help us identify, design, and drive the implementation of new automated auditing opportunities across the US Corporate Audit teams with a specific focus on the Global Markets, Global Banking, and Market Risk areas. The role will involve working closely with the line of business auditors to identify new automation opportunities and with the Automation development teams to deliver the tools needed to enhance and support audit work.

Working with all levels of the Audit team from Senior Audit Director to Senior Auditor, you will be one of three business analysts covering the automation developments for all the audit activities in the Global Markets, Global Banking and Market Risk audit team globally as well as audit activities in the International Audit team. This specific role will have focus on the US Corporate Audit teams, your peers being based in EMEA and APAC respectively. You will work under the supervision of the Senior Quantitative Finance Manager for Market Risk and Automation. This team has been the lead innovator in identifying new automation tools in Client Corporate Audit, implementing the first Python scripted tools, the first model-based audit testing and driving the delivery of self-service data interfaces. Team members will be able to network across the Bank with the various teams developing innovative data tools.

Responsibilities:

  • Providing guidance and support to audit teams as they identify new automation opportunities.
  • Autonomously identifying new use cases for automation tools and working on proof of concept to assess usefulness.
  • Supporting, writing, and managing the definition of business requirements and functional requirements, as required, to convert automation ideas into usable automated functionality in audit testing or risk monitoring.
  • Monitoring and assisting the Automation development teams to drive timely and quality delivery of automation capabilities.
  • Working with the Automation development teams to assess skill and infrastructure needs based on the pipeline of new tools needed to support the audit team.

We Are Looking For Someone Who:

  • Understands the basics of the software development lifecycle and the role of the business analyst within it.
  • Understands internal audit's role and objectives and how automation can be leveraged for risk monitoring or control testing.
  • Has a strong interest in exploring new automation developments and assess them for their potential applicability to auditing.
  • Can identify ways to exploit automation tools for audit testing and risk monitoring.
  • Can translate automation ideas into business and functional requirements that a software developer can use.
  • Can quickly understand and exploit the metadata of commonly used data sources to be able to assist developers in fine tuning automation reports to meet the audit objective.
  • A good communicator who can explain the advantages of, and train auditors on, new automation tools.

Required Skills:

  • Has a minimum 5-8 years of experience across a combination of relevant experiences in at least two of relevant areas.
  • Has practical experience developing programmatic approaches to enhance business routine productivity, efficiency, and effectiveness and/or experience in the development lifecycle for applications/systems to enhance business routine productivity, efficiency, and effectiveness.
  • Has sustained experience effectively communicating with both technical and business audiences/stakeholders.

Desired Skills:

  • An understanding of Global Market, Global Banking, and/or Market Risk
  • Coding proficiency (e.g. Python, VBA, C++, SQL)
  • Ability to use data analytics applications
